Teaching Procedures
Activities Pre
– activity ±10 minutes
3. Students get brainstorming from the teacher to construct their background knowledge that related to the topic with answering several questions as
stimulant. For example: T:
“Do you know about announcement text?” “Have you ever read announcement text?”
It is used to build the students’ thought before they learn further about announcement text.
2. Students listen to the teacher’s explanation about material they are going to
learn – that is about ―Beach Party‖, the goals of learning to achieve, and
reading strategies the students use.
While activity ± 65 minutes
II. The teacher distributes the announcement text to all students and instructs
them to write 6 questions based on the text. III.
The students underline the main idea they find in the text and make questions i.e. What is the announcement text about?
IV. The other students write the answers on a piece of paper.
XV. The students underline the time and the place that they find and make
questions about it. The possible questions are When the programme will be carried out?,, Where is the party will be carried out?
XVI. The other students write the answers on a piece of paper.
II. The students make an inference or prediction about the purpose of the
announcement text.
Post activity ± 10 minutes
9. Students ask the teacher about the difficulties in understanding the lesson. 10. Students infer what they have just already learned and get the conclusion
from the teacher.
